5 out of 5 stars overall. Signature Healthcare of Monroe County Rehab and We has a 5-star health inspection rating, 4-star staffing, and 3-star quality measures rating; it reported 3.88 nurse hours per resident per day versus the 4.1 federal benchmark, with $0 in fines in the last 24 months.

What the inspectors found

The home failed to provide safe and appropriate breathing care when a resident needed it. Cited May 2024 — isolated incident,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 695 — 42 CFR §483.25(i) — S/S: D

The nursing home failed to provide and carry out an infection prevention and control program to help keep residents from getting or spreading infections. Cited April 2019 — isolated incident,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 880 — 42 CFR §483.80(a) — S/S: D
